Fig. 6From: Manganese-enhanced MRI for the detection of metastatic potential in colorectal cancer a and b are a histological photomicrographs (hematoxylin and eosin × 40) and CD34 immunohistochemical staining (×200) of a DLD-1 tumour, respectively. In a, packed tumour cells with little interstitium (black arrow) and discrete necrosis (white arrow) are shown. In b, black arrows point to sparse microvessels. c and d are a histological photomicrograph (haematoxylin and eosin × 100) and CD34 immunohistochemical staining (×200) of a SW620 tumour, respectively. In c, relatively little interstitium (white arrow) is noted in packed tumour cells. In d, white arrows indicate sparse microvesselsBack to article page
